Sumario:In the University faculties, as in every organization, there are Organizational entities that have functions related to human resource management, such as the administrative management, academic department, faculties, even the committee assessment and the theaching improvement. In the context described above, our interest is to develope a study concerned with the following objectives: To have an assignment system charge of the professors of the Mathematic Science Faculty, in particular in the Operational Research deparment, which guarantees an objective and impartial distribution that will allow to select the suitable professor to teach a particular course, with this purpose, it has been formulated a linear program model. Moreover, we set out a Markov's chain which translate in a transition probability matrix the changes of category of the permanent professor of the Mathematic Science Faculty among consecutives professor promotion procedure.
